Understanding the Role of an ai assistant for enterprise teams

Definition and Functionality

An ai assistant for enterprise teams is a sophisticated digital tool designed to enhance productivity by automating routine tasks, facilitating collaboration, and managing workflows. It leverages artificial intelligence to streamlining the administrative burden that often hampers team efficiency. Its core functionalities include scheduling meetings, managing emails, organizing files, and providing real-time insights into project statuses. By integrating seamlessly with existing software, such as project management tools, communication platforms, and CRMs, it acts as a cohesive unit that unifies various enterprise functions.

Benefits of Integration

Integrating an ai assistant into enterprise workflows offers several tangible benefits. First and foremost is the increase in productivity; teams can focus on strategic tasks rather than mundane chores. Second, enhanced collaboration is another significant advantage, as these assistants facilitate easier communication among team members, reducing delays and misunderstandings. Additionally, the use of an ai assistant aids in data-driven decision-making, providing teams with timely insights based on analyzed data patterns. Ultimately, the adoption of such technology leads to a more agile, efficient workspace that adapts quickly to changing business needs.

Common Use Cases

Common use cases for an ai assistant in enterprise settings include scheduling and managing meetings, task delegation, document management, and providing analytical reports. For example, during project kick-offs, the ai assistant could gather all relevant team members, propose meeting times, prepare agendas, and document minutes—all of which are critical for aligning objectives from the onset. In addition, these tools can track project timelines and deadlines, sending reminders to ensure that projects remain on schedule.

Key Features of an ai assistant for enterprise teams

Task Automation Capabilities

Task automation is perhaps the most vital feature of an ai assistant. By automating routine processes, such as data entry, report generation, and task assignments, teams benefit from reduced workloads and fewer errors. A powerful ai assistant can leverage machine learning algorithms to learn team preferences, making smarter decisions over time. For example, it could identify the best time for weekly check-ins based on past calendar activities and the availability of team members.

Collaboration Tools Integration

Seamless integration with existing collaboration tools is essential for maximizing the effectiveness of an ai assistant. Whether it’s CRM software, project management platforms, or communication applications, an effective ai assistant can pull data across multiple platforms and present it cohesively. This not only eliminates the redundancy of data entry but also ensures that teams can access critical information quickly and efficiently. For instance, when a team member starts a conversation in a communication app about a new project, the ai assistant can retrieve past project files and team notes directly related to that conversation.

Data Analysis and Insights

Another crucial feature of an ai assistant is its ability to analyze large datasets and offer actionable insights. By sifting through data, the assistant can identify trends, spot potential issues, and recommend strategic actions. For instance, it can analyze sales data over time to suggest areas where marketing efforts could be amplified. This type of data-driven insight is invaluable for steering projects in the right direction and ensuring teams are consistently aligned with organizational goals.

Implementing an ai assistant for enterprise teams

Choosing the Right Solution

To implement an effective ai assistant, organizations must first identify their unique needs and choose the right solution accordingly. This involves evaluating various options based on functionality, ease of integration, user interface, and customer support. Teams should also consider how well each solution aligns with existing tools and workflows. Considering feedback from other users can provide valuable insights into each option’s strengths and weaknesses.

Steps for Seamless Integration

Successful implementation of an ai assistant requires careful planning. Begin by establishing clear objectives for what you want the assistant to accomplish. Next, involve stakeholders early in the process to gather input and ensure buy-in. Following that, configure the assistant to mirror your workflow and integrate it into existing systems. Testing the ai assistant in a controlled environment helps identify any issues before a full rollout. Training sessions for team members can facilitate smoother adoption of the new tool.

Training and Adoption Strategies

Training is an essential part of ensuring team members effectively utilize the ai assistant. Conduct hands-on workshops that demonstrate how to leverage the assistant for various tasks, such as scheduling, task management, and data analysis. Create supportive materials like user manuals, FAQs, and quick-start guides to help users navigate the new system. Engage team members through continuous feedback mechanisms to optimize performance and address challenges as they arise.

Measuring Success with an ai assistant for enterprise teams

Key Performance Indicators

To ensure the ai assistant contributes positively to organizational productivity, measurable key performance indicators (KPIs) should be established. These may include the time saved on recurring tasks, user adoption rates, accuracy improvements, and overall team productivity. Regularly reviewing these metrics allows organizations to understand the assistant’s impact and make necessary adjustments to improve its effectiveness further.

Feedback Mechanisms

Establishing feedback mechanisms is crucial to honing the performance of the ai assistant. This can involve periodic surveys and assessments to gather user experiences and suggestions. Regular feedback loops not only help identify areas for improvement but also foster a culture of continuous improvement among team members. Incorporating user feedback can lead to enhanced features that further increase productivity and satisfaction.
